I chose this visualization because, although the image looked colorful and creative, it was difficult for me to extract information from this visualization. I could see from this visualization that there were a lot of things that can be improved, at least to make all the data clearer.

Inspired by the critique method, I realized that the visualization was not well done in terms of usefulness, perceptibility, and intuitiveness. It did not allow people to easily compare data to generate useful insights. The colors used for classification were too close. Using the school’s school badge to indicate the name of the school made the information unclear. According to the critique method, I think this type of graph may not be appropriate in this data visualization. The audience for this chart was likely to be some students or parents who needed to choose a school. They preferred to see comparisons among schools. Thus, if I would redesign this visualization, I might choose simple bar chart to show the data clearly and make the data comparable. I would also display the name of the school and state to indicate which school and state the data belonged to. In addition, I would sort the bar chart to make it easier for comparison.

The bullet graph showed the graduates’ salary and the net cost of the best college in each state. From the chart, we could see that the graduates from Stanford University in CA got the highest salary in US in 2019. Also, the cost of Stanford University was relatively acceptable compared to others. We could conclude that Stanford University would be a wise choice. Although the graduates from Duke University got a high average early career salary, the cost of studying at this school cannot be underestimated. When choosing a school, people should not only pay attention to the average early career salary, but also the cost of attending the school. Many people thought that the higher the salary of graduates, the higher the cost. However, through this visualization, we cannot make such a conclusion. For example, U.S. Air Force Academy, which ranks second in salary, allowed graduates to get high pay without spending any money.

The reason why I used bullet graph was that bullet graph seemed to be a simple chart that everyone was familiar with. It would be much easier for students and parents to get information from the visualization. Because it was much like a bar chart, it was easy to understand, but it had more information than a bar chart. In general, the bullet graph was a simple and informative chart. In addition, bullet graph could enable the audience to compare among the schools using both the costs and salaries.
